At what age does bone mass reach its peak level in both males and females?
a. puberty
b. 16-18 years
c. 20-25 years
d. 25-30 years
Answer: d. 25-30 years
Bone mass reaches its peak level in both males and females at about 25-30 years of age. Strenuous exercise or injuries that occur prior to this time can result in disruptions to the normal growth pattern of the bone.
